Background technology
Gas-steam boiler is by the use of gaseous fuels such as natural gas, liquefied gas, town gas as fuel, burns and puts in stove Water that heat out comes in heating kettle simultaneously makes thermal energy conversion equipment of its vaporization in steam;Water is in pot constantly by gas in stove The energy warms temperature that fluid fuel burning releases increases and generates pressurized vapor, so as to form heat power, as a kind of energy Source is widely used in numerous areas.
Compared with fossil fuel, gaseous fuel has many advantages, such as that burning is easy to control, the thermal efficiency is high, free from environmental pollution, Through the trend for becoming energy industry.But due to combustion gas price costly, the cold water of similary quality is converted into steaming Gas is often higher than the cost using coal-burning boiler using the cost of gas fired-boiler;Therefore, how to make full use of the energy, reduce combustion The problem of gas energy consumption reduces gas-steam boiler cost, is urgent need to resolve.

The present invention is using above-mentioned technical proposal, advantage:The present invention provides a kind of steamings of New energy-conserving fuel gas Boiler furnace heating system, simple in structure, reasonable design takes full advantage of clean energy resource and residual heat from boiler fume, greatly reduces The consumption of combustion gas, energy-saving effect are very notable.The tap water of low temperature after solar heat collector preheats, by preheating water send to Condensation energy-saving device is heated to be high-temperature water, then high-temperature water is added in boiler, is then converted to steam, and pot is directly entered than water at low temperature Steam is converted into stove reduces gas consumption.Meanwhile all water tanks and pipeline are respectively provided with insulating layer, can ensure water to greatest extent Case water temperature.
The sewerage of gas-steam boiler also has higher temperature, send after purification and is recycled into preheating water tank, Hot water stream is effectively prevent to become estranged the secondary water environment pollution of softened water, makes full use of thermal water resource.
Running water filter and soft brush treatment device are additionally provided in present system, eliminates calcium ions and magnesium ions, is reduced originally The hardness of water prevents the fouling in pipeline, water tank and boiler, protects the safety of equipment and good, the reduction equipment of heat transfer property Damage and the waste of combustion gas, ensure being smoothed out for production.

Compared with the prior art, increase preheating water tank 06, the hot water and blow-off line that solar heat collector 05 is generated 12 purified 09 purified hot water of device are sent into preheating water tank 06, then are heated as high-temperature water by condensation energy-saving device 08 and are sent into combustion gas Steam boiler 01 ensures that the water temperature of high-temperature water is not suffered a loss, further reduces gas consumption in this way.
Further, the high-temperature water feedwater piping 11 between the high-temperature water tank 07 and the gas-steam boiler 01 On be provided with two high-temperature water feed pumps 13, and the high-temperature water feed pump 13 is is arranged in parallel.
It is arranged in parallel using two high-temperature water feed pumps 13, it is ensured that high-temperature water feed pump 13 1 opens standby a, guarantor convenient to overhaul It supports, ensures that high-temperature water continuously supplies.
Further, on the preheating water feedwater piping 14 between the condensation energy-saving device 08 and the preheating water tank 06 Two preheating water feed pumps 15 are provided with, and the preheating water feed pump 15 is is arranged in parallel.
Be arranged in parallel using two preheating water feed pumps 15, it is ensured that high preheating water feed pump 15 1 open it is one standby, it is convenient to overhaul Maintenance ensures that preheating water continuously supplies.
Further, 10 outer wall of water supply pipe is provided with low-pressure steam heat tracing, and outside the water supply pipe 10 Wall surface is provided with insulating layer, and insulating layer is by the water supply pipe 10, low-pressure steam heat tracing tight.
Low-pressure steam heat tracing and insulating layer are set in water supply pipe, ensure that pipeline is not in that pipeline freezes in winter Phenomenon, while low-pressure steam heat tracing also provides certain pre- heat effect for the tap water of low temperature.

The one of the New energy-conserving fuel gas steam boiler heating system of the present invention is preferably as follows using process:From running water pipe The tap water in road 10 by filter 02 filtering after enter demineralized water treatment device 03, remove tap water in calcium and magnesium plasma after enter it is cold In water tank 04, sent after the preheating of solar heat collector 05 to preheating water tank 06, preheating water feed pump 15 by preheating water send to Condensation energy-saving device 09 is sent after being heated into high-temperature water to high-temperature water tank 07, and high-temperature water is sent into combustion and steam pot by high-temperature water feed pump 13 Steam is converted into stove 01.
The sewage generated in 01 operational process of gas-steam boiler is sent after the processing of clarifier 09 to 06 weight of preheating water tank It is multiple to utilize.
